A friend of mine pointed this out. Adductor and abductor exercises are very good for pelvic floor muscles. I've even read that it helps with the bladder and this helps us going through menopause or in woman in general having to go to the toilet so much during night.
She said that she hates using the bands as she often looses her balance being an older women.

When she spoke with the male gym manager about how most women and expecting mums should have access to weight assisted adductor and abductor equiptment where they can sit down and workout safer, he said 'there’s no room - and just use bands around legs for glutes!'
Hmm some confusion about muscle groups but my suggestions would be using this equipment or these exercises as alternatives.

I haven't trained since I fell/ flew over a box at work Dec 2022. Luckily I avoided breaking my knee caps but they were so painful that I couldn't kneel for a year. That pain eclipsed that fact that I had a broken foot - a fractured metatarsal that all the X-rays, ultrasound, plus podiatrist and physios couldn't pick up. I knew it wasn't right and persistence with a nuclear bone density scan finally showed it up. Standing and walking at work definatley took their toll as I was so exhausted from every step I took that I had to rest in between, before and after any shifts. So now it's a moon boot! What I have continued with is Yin yoga to keep my mobility and rom good. Now to get back to some upper body work!
